Output 0704106bdd0e1c92f5a257af74e572dda281226289a9c8ac87ece303b6d9dde8:35

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3831a2a587792e448fdc0d6944f3e2a2e73fbb158caa5bd847633bd763292078
address
tb1p8qc69fv80yhyfr7up455fulz5tnnlwc43j49hkz8vvaawcefypuq3d76dp
transaction
0704106bdd0e1c92f5a257af74e572dda281226289a9c8ac87ece303b6d9dde8
confirmations
33927
spent
true